Federal Oversight Supervisor (WMS2/DBHR)
at Washington State Department of Social and Health Services
Federal Oversight Supervisor (WMS2/DBHR) 71115128 As the Federal Oversight Supervisor for the Division of Behavioral Health and Recovery (DBHR), you will serve as the premier authority on federal grants and compliance. Reporting directly to the DBHR Director and Chief of Staff, you will lead high-priority, high-risk projects that directly shape the state's healthcare landscape. You will manage a talented, multidisciplinary team to optimize millions of dollars in federal resources, including vital SAMHSA Block Grants (MHBG and SUPTRS) and emergency response funds (FEMA).
